Re: best MMORPG
Quote:
|
Originally Posted by Phobos
is there any mmorpg's that are good and free? i just don't see paying $10 or more a month to play a game...
|
I'm not into the pay2play scams either. I played Maple Story for about 6 months. It's a ton of fun if you like old-school platforming games, but the level grind got to be too much for me (at least 10 hours of killing the same thing on the same map to level up once). Now I'm just waiting for Guild Wars to be released. I played in a couple of the beta events, and it's incredibly fun. My favorite part about it is that there's a low level cap, so the game focuses on skill rather than on hours played.
